School Overview

Virginia Wesleyan University, based in Virginia Beach, VA, provides students with a comprehensive academic experience. It holds the #178 position in National Liberal Arts Colleges according to the 2026 U.S. News rankings. It is also recognized as #140 in Top Performers on Social Mobility. The school features a suburban setting and serves 1,749 undergraduate students. With an acceptance rate of 73%, Virginia Wesleyan University is moderately competitive. The average high school GPA of incoming freshmen is 3.3. The student-faculty ratio is 15:1, ensuring personalized instruction and close mentorship. About 81% of classes enroll fewer than 20 students, fostering an intimate learning environment. The most popular areas of study include Business and Management (18%), Interdisciplinary Studies (10%), and Biological Sciences (8%). Graduates in Business and Management earn a median salary of $59,057 after entering the workforce. Annual tuition and fees are $38,780, with room and board adding approximately $12,170. The average net price for students receiving financial aid is $22,807. Virginia Wesleyan University achieves a four-year graduation rate of 36%. Virginia Wesleyan University Bachelor's Program Overview

Virginia Wesleyan University, a private institution, has been offering online bachelor's degree programs since 2017-2018. All of the online classes are recorded and archived so students can access lecture material at their convenience. When applying for the online programs at Virginia Wesleyan University, it's important to note that the deadline is rolling.
We offer online degrees that are as rigorous as our face to face degrees. We offer small classes, and promote a community of learners within those small classes. Some of our OBD courses require community engagement or hands-on experiences where the student lives. We stress an interdisciplinary liberal arts approach.
